What You Must Do To Win

Anthony Iannarino

Desire to Win : You aren’t going to win if you can live with a loss. You are not going to win if there isn’t something burning inside you. The burning desire is the starting point of winning. You have to want it like you want your next breath. You have to feel it, like a hunger , an unquenchable, insatiable need, one that isn’t easily going to be assuaged.

Innisfree Hotels Breaks Ground on Dual-Branded Marriott Hotel in Amelia Island

Innisfree Hotels

GULF BREEZE, FLA. – December 3, 2019 – Innisfree Hotels has broken ground on its latest development project, a dual-branded SpringHill Suites and Courtyard by Marriott hotel located at 2900 Atlantic Avenue in Amelia Island, Fla. The hotel company will partner with Main Beach Sojourn LLLP, carrying on a 26-year affiliation of principals associated with the former Amelia Island Care Center located on the site.

Why You Need To Believe Sales Success Is Not Situational

Anthony Iannarino

Success in sales isn’t situational. I need offer no greater explanation than success itself is individual, a statement that is easily supported by the evidence. That said, here is the case for success in sales being individual, not situational. General Truth 1: Everything Is the Same. Imagine the most successful sales organization. The salespeople who make up that sales force has a top twenty-percent , a middle sixty-percent, and a bottom twenty-percent.

Leadership and the Remarkably High Cost of Low Expectations

Anthony Iannarino

Your standard as a leader is not what you believe to be your standard. Instead, your standard is what you allow, what you accept, what occurs without your objection or consequences. Over time, you can be lulled into expecting less from the people you lead. The result of low expectations is not reaching your full potential and not helping others achieve theirs.

How Your Superstitions About Monday Calls Ruins Your Results

Anthony Iannarino

Or, an alternative title: Never Give Up Your Monday. Or Any Other Day. I overheard a salesperson explain why they didn’t call the client with whom they are engaged in a rather serious sales conversation. This salesperson’s prospective client has a real and compelling need around a result that is nothing if not strategic. The reason the salesperson offered for not following up with their motivated prospect is that it is a Monday, and they didn’t want to be all over them right after the weekend.
